specific Embodiment approach 2

[0070] Specific embodiment two, combine Figure 4 to Figure 6 To describe this embodiment, a certain military anti-surface warfare process is taken as an example. The order from the superior was to capture the South and North Beaches and the Highlands.

[0071] 1. Create an instance for the created ontology framework;

[0072] The creation of the action class instance in the action ontology is the key point, and the instances of other classes are created according to the actual situation. Action instance creation Figure 4 shown.

[0073] The action class instance is created, and the action process of all plans can be divided into three tasks. There are some actions in each mission: capture the high ground, capture the North Beach, capture the South Beach, and each stage is divided into several simple tasks. Abstract

The invention discloses an action sequence reasoning method for a military action body based on a hierarchical task network, relates to the field of body planning, and solves the problems that space resources cannot be well utilized and body construction is complex in the prior art. The method comprises the steps: constructing a structure frame for a plan action body; constructing a correspondingmilitary plan body by using Protege software according to the framework, extracting a plan problem and a plan domain, solving the converted plan problem by using an HTN planner JSHOP2, and finally obtaining an action sequence. According to the invention, the body construction scale of the action body is simplified. An body reasoning problem is converted into a plan problem, and a new method is provided for automatically generating a military action sequence. According to the method, plan reasoning is carried out on the current war situation by utilizing a hierarchical task network method, anddecision making is carried out more effectively.

Description

technical field [0001] The invention relates to the field of ontology planning, in particular to an action sequence reasoning method of a military action ontology based on a hierarchical task network, which solves the problem of action ontology planning by using the hierarchical task network planning method. Background technique [0002] Ontology is the basis of semantic interoperability between command information system and combat simulation system, and most of the dynamic generation and verification of decision-oriented intelligent combat action processes are based on ontology. Ontology uses description logic to formalize military operations to form an ontology in the field of military operations. [0003] In joint operations under the conditions of informationization, the efficiency and quality of the combat plan affect the success or failure of the war, and the formulation of the combat plan has attracted attention both at home and abroad.
